首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>你如何在火猴中获取默认的系统颜色?

你如何在火猴中获取默认的系统颜色?
EN

Stack Overflow用户
提问于 2015-01-19 23:11:34
回答 1查看 813关注 0票数 1

在FireMonkey中,如何获取常用界面元素的系统颜色?

例如,在VCL中,您将使用其中一个颜色常量(例如,clWindow, clBtnFace, clMenu用于窗口、按钮和菜单的颜色)。或者,如果使用自定义样式,则可以使用style API's GetSystemColor

然而,FireMonkey是跨平台的,并且没有等价的常量,也没有在其样式系统中公开的项。如何以跨平台的方式获取这些或类似的值?

EN

回答 1

Stack Overflow用户

发布于 2015-01-20 06:57:12

FireMonkey没有或使用任何系统定义的颜色,颜色是显式的RGBA值。FireMonkey具有颜色常量,但它们是固定的RGBA值,不会在运行时由操作系统解析。简而言之,系统定义的颜色是VCL的一个特定于Windows的特性,在FireMonkey中不可用。

票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/28027739

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档